I'm a little late to the party, only now reading the Jesse Stone series from first to last. Thoroughly enjoyed the original Robt B Parker books ... quick, brisk, snappy dialogue and well-crafted stories. Brandman captured the dialogue in his few books, but wasn't nearly the story teller. Coleman swings the other direction; while he crafts an intricate story (and uses a million words in the process), everything about the dialogue is off and out-of-character. If I were picking up this book 'cold', unburdened by the prior versions against which to compare, I'd probably like it just fine. As a continuation of the series, however, I admit to being disappointed ... not what I would have chosen to see happen to the 'brand'.
